The ukulele, a small string instrument originating from Hawaii, has made a significant impact on the synth-pop music genre in recent years. Traditionally associated with Hawaiian music, the ukulele has found its way into the mainstream music scene, particularly in synth-pop, where its unique sound adds a quirky and whimsical element to the music.

Synth-pop, a genre that emerged in the late 1970s, is characterized by its use of synthesizers and electronic sound production. In recent years, artists have been incorporating the ukulele into synth-pop music, creating a fusion of the traditional and the futuristic. The ukulele’s bright and cheerful tones provide a refreshing contrast to the electronic sounds of synth-pop, adding depth and texture to the music.

One reason for the popularity of the ukulele in synth-pop music is its accessibility. Unlike larger, more intimidating instruments, the ukulele is relatively easy to learn and play, making it an attractive option for musicians of all skill levels. This accessibility has led to an increase in ukulele players in the music industry, contributing to its rising prominence in synth-pop music.

In addition to its accessibility, the ukulele’s rising popularity in synth-pop can also be attributed to its ability to evoke a sense of nostalgia and playfulness. Its cheerful and carefree sound resonates with listeners, offering a nostalgic nod to simpler times. This nostalgic appeal has made the ukulele a sought-after instrument in the synth-pop music scene, where artists aim to capture the whimsy and charm of bygone eras.

As synth-pop continues to evolve, the ukulele’s presence in the genre is likely to grow, as more artists seek to incorporate its unique sound into their music. With its accessibility and nostalgic appeal, the ukulele is poised to remain a staple instrument in synth-pop, adding a touch of warmth and nostalgia to the genre’s futuristic soundscape.

The Rise of Ukulele in Synth-Pop Music

Ukulele, a small four-stringed instrument with its origins in Hawaii, has been making a significant impact on the synth-pop music genre in recent years. Synth-pop, characterized by its use of electronic synthesizers and catchy melodies, has seen a surge in the inclusion of ukulele in its soundscapes. This unlikely combination has brought a fresh and unique element to the genre, captivating audiences and creating a new wave of sonic experimentation.

Unconventional Blend of Sounds

The ukulele, with its bright and cheerful tones, adds a contrasting layer to the electronic sounds typically found in synth-pop music. This blend of acoustic and electronic elements creates a dynamic and intriguing sonic landscape that sets synth-pop tracks featuring the ukulele apart from the rest. Artists and producers have embraced this unconventional combination, pushing the boundaries of the genre and creating music that is both familiar and innovative.

Experimental Songwriting

With the inclusion of ukulele in synth-pop music, songwriters have been able to explore new musical avenues. The unique timbre of the ukulele has inspired fresh melodies and lyrical themes, allowing for a more experimental approach to songwriting in the genre. This has led to the creation of songs that are whimsical, introspective, and emotionally resonant, adding depth and diversity to the synth-pop music landscape.

Live Performances and Audience Connection

Live performances of synth-pop music featuring the ukulele have also contributed to the instrument’s rise in the genre. The intimate and inviting nature of the ukulele creates a special connection between the musicians and their audience, enhancing the live music experience. This has resulted in a growing demand for synth-pop acts incorporating the ukulele into their performances, further solidifying its place in the genre.

What is the role of the ukulele in synth-pop music?

The ukulele in synth-pop music serves as a unique and unexpected element that adds warmth and organic texture to the electronic sound.

Which synth-pop artists use the ukulele in their music?

Some notable synth-pop artists that incorporate the ukulele in their music include Twenty One Pilots, Billie Eilish, and The Magnetic Fields.

How is the ukulele integrated into synth-pop songs?

The ukulele is often used to create catchy and memorable melodies, as well as to add a folk or tropical vibe to the overall sound of the song.

Can the ukulele be used for both lead and rhythm parts in synth-pop music?

Yes, the ukulele can be versatile in synth-pop music, with some songs featuring the ukulele as the lead instrument and others using it for rhythmic support.

What type of ukulele is commonly used in synth-pop music?

The soprano ukulele is the most commonly used size in synth-pop music, as its bright and cheerful tone fits well with the genre’s aesthetic.

How does the ukulele blend with synthesizers and electronic beats in synth-pop music?

The ukulele adds a contrasting organic element to the electronic sounds, creating an interesting fusion of acoustic and digital textures in the music.

Are there specific techniques for playing the ukulele in synth-pop music?

While traditional ukulele strumming and picking techniques can be used, some synth-pop songs may call for more percussive or rhythmic playing styles to complement the electronic elements.

Can the ukulele be effectively used in live synth-pop performances?

Yes, the ukulele can be integrated into live synth-pop performances, adding a visually and sonically appealing element to the stage presence of the artists.

Are there any challenges in mixing the ukulele with synthesizers in synth-pop music?

One challenge is ensuring that the ukulele’s acoustic sound blends well with the electronic elements in the mix, requiring careful EQ and effects adjustments to achieve a cohesive sound.

How can aspiring musicians incorporate the ukulele into their own synth-pop compositions?

Aspiring musicians can experiment with incorporating the ukulele into their synth-pop compositions by exploring different chord progressions, strumming patterns, and effects to create a unique and personalized sound.
